01 · Timnath

A newer opening can still move, settle, wear, or fall out of adjustment

A door that drags or misses the latch can reflect hinge condition, hardware preparation, frame alignment, threshold interference, installation, or building movement. Replacing the slab without checking those relationships may preserve the original problem.

For windows and patio doors, document the frame, sill, perimeter, operating hardware, drainage, and any air or water symptoms. Full-opening photos plus close-ups help separate a service request from a planned replacement.

02 · Timnath

Commercial requests move faster when the opening is identified early

For a project opening, share the opening number, schedule, wall type, handing, frame and door preparation, hardware set, finished-floor condition, and project stage. For an occupied facility, share the location, symptom, traffic, and hardware involved.

A-1's lane is physical pedestrian-door, frame, and hardware work. Wiring, programming, automatic sliding doors, storefront glass, and unconfirmed certification services remain outside scope.

03 · Timnath

Timnath permit and contractor-license checkpoint

Timnath Building & Construction Services provides homeowner and contractor resources. Contractors submit through CommunityCore, use CommunityConnect for documents, and must complete Town licensing before permit issuance.

Do not assume every like-for-like replacement needs the same submission. Confirm the project type, address, documents, and inspection path with the Town.

Requirements change. Confirm the current rule for the project address with the authority having jurisdiction.
